Britain will ban under-16s from social media apps, including TikTok and YouTube

The ban will apply to platforms including Snapchat, TikTok, YouTube, Instagram, Facebook and X. The move makes the U.K. part of a growing global movement to tighten online safety for children.

The UK government has announced plans to restrict access to social media platforms for users under the age of 16. The proposed ban would apply to popular apps such as TikTok, YouTube, Snapchat, Instagram, Facebook, and X, effectively limiting their use by minors. This move aligns the UK with a growing trend of countries seeking to enhance online safety for children, indicating a shift in global attitudes towards regulating social media usage among young users.
